  • Charcoal confusion? new study tests if common treatment skews lab results

    Knowledge-focused Not yet recruiting

    This study looks at whether taking activated charcoal, a treatment sometimes used for poisonings, can change certain blood test results. Eight healthy adults will take a dose of charcoal and have their blood drawn over several hours. The goal is to see if the charcoal causes fals…
